Tesla reports ‘historic’ profitable quarter

SAN FRANCISCO, United States (AFP) — Electric car maker Tesla on Wednesday reported a “historic” profitable quarter driven by demand for its Model 3 aimed at the mass market. Tesla said net income reached $311.5 million on revenue that more than doubled to $6.8 billion in the quarter that ended September 30. Tokyo’s Nikkei index drops 2.67% amid global risk worries

TOKYO, Japan (AFP) — Tokyo’s benchmark Nikkei index dropped 2.67 percent on Tuesday amid lingering worries over geopolitical risks and ahead of the corporate earnings report season. China’s GDP growth slows to 6.5 percent in third quarter

by Ryan MCMORROW Agence France Presse BEIJING, China (AFP) — China’s economy grew at its slowest pace in nine years in the third quarter, as a campaign to tackle mounting debt and trade frictions with the US had an effect. The world’s second largest economy expanded by 6.5 percent in the July-to-September period year-on-year, according to official GDP figures released Friday by China’s National Bureau of Statistics. Japan inflation edges up to 1% in September

TOKYO, Japan (AFP) — Prices in Japan inched up by one percent in September, according to government data published Friday, as the world’s third-largest economy continues its years-long struggle with deflation. Inflation stood at one percent year-on-year in September, the first time it had reached that level since February, but still only halfway to the Bank of Japan’s two-percent target.
